If you want something non-litrpg that is excellent, check out The Black Ocean: Galaxy Outlaws. It is a HUGE series, with multiple spin-offs. The entire main series can be purchased for a single credit on audible, and contains 16 full books, plus a short. The voice acting is amazing, the characters are fun, the world building is pretty great (and manages to combine magic and advanced tech in an interesting and novel way), and the value for your credit is through the roof: the main series is 85 hours. For 1 credit.
